Key Responsibilities:
Recruiting:
- Assist with the recruitment process by identifying candidates, scheduling interviews, conducting testing, tracking employment applications, and arranging interviews.
- Organize planning meetings for hiring when staff is identified.
- Examine applicants' resumes and select candidates for job openings.
Onboarding:
- Coordinate new employee paperwork and meetings.
- Communicate new hire information downstream and conduct employee orientations and tours.
- Implement new hire orientation
Personnel & Regulatory Administration:
- Coordinate and organize administrative tasks related to human resources functions
- Maintain compliance with federal, state, and local employment laws and regulations, recommend best practices, and review policies and practices to ensure compliance.
- Verify I-9 documentation for new hires, rehires, and existing employees to ensure employment eligibility.
Performance Management:
- Assist with performance management procedures, providing administrative support, and helping management plan monthly performance meetings.
Employee Relations:
- Assist in creating and disseminating the company's employee relations policies in HR.
- Suggest employee relations techniques to build a strong rapport between employers and employees and encourage high levels of motivation and morale.
- Participate in the investigation process when grievances or concerns are raised by employees.
- Attend and participate in employee disciplinary meetings, terminations, and investigations.
- Handle employment-related inquiries from applicants, employees, and supervisors, referring to complex and/or sensitive matters.
Benefits Administration:
- May assist with benefits administration tasks as needed.
Payroll & Timesheet Management:
- Assist with payroll and manage timesheets.
Driver DOT File Maintenance:
- Maintain Driver DOT files.
Special Projects:
- Assist with special projects as needed.
- Complete additional tasks as assigned.
Qualifications:
- Bachelor's deg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, or related field preferred.
- 1-3 years of experience in human resources or related administrative support roles.
- Strong understanding of HR principles, practices, and employment law.
- Excellent organizational and time management skills.
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ills.
- Proficiency in Google Suite and HRIS systems.
- Ability to handle confidential information with discretion.
